Role PurposeThe Treasurer plays a vital role on the Board of Trustees, providing financial oversight and strategic guidance to ensure the charity remains financially sustainable, compliant, and well-governed.
Key ResponsibilitiesGovernance & Strategy
Serve as an active member of the Board of Trustees
Contribute to the strategic direction and sustainability of the charity
Ensure the organisation complies with financial regulations and charity law
Financial Oversight
Monitor the financial health of the organisation
Review and present financial reports at board meetings
Ensure appropriate financial controls and procedures are in place
Oversee budgeting, forecasting, and financial planning processes
Reporting & Compliance
Ensure the preparation and submission of annual accounts and returns (e.g. Charity Commission)
Liaise with independent examiners or auditors as required
Ensure compliance with relevant financial legislation and best practice
Operational Support
Work with staff (or volunteers) responsible for day-to-day finance
Provide advice on financial implications of projects and funding bids
Support funding strategy with financial insight
